Prevention of Radiocontrast Media Induced Nephropathy by Short-Term High-Dose Statin in Renal Insufficiency Undergoing Coronary Angiography (PROMISS)
The contrast induced kidney toxicity has been known to affect the mortality and morbidity in the patients undergoing coronary angiography. But the mechanism and therapeutic strategy for it is not well known. Nowadays, it is reported that the N-acetylcysteine may have preventive effects for contrast induced kidney toxicity with its antioxidant effects.The statins have been reported to have many other effects other than the lipid lowering effect-including antioxidant effect, so we hypothesized that the antioxidant effect of simvastatin may prevent the contrast induced kidney toxicity.
The simvastatin may prevent the contrast agent induced acute renal failure in the patients with underlying renal insufficiency who is undergoing the coronary angiography. The effect may derive from the antioxidant function of simvastatin.
